Profile bio

About John Rehm

John Rehm is a geologist with forty years of field and reporting experience across the Unitied States with deep work experience in the Northeast, Mid-Continent and the Pacific Northwest parts of the country. Presently, he describes and maps groundwater resources for residential and municipal growth in western Oregon. He also prepares and maintains water right applications and records for Oregon irrigators. His field work includes; sampling, geologic mapping, water level measurements in wells, state pump tests, aquifer tests and field assistance in drilling projects and geophysical surveys. Mr. Rehm is familiar with hydrological aspects and mineral and water resources of the Oregon Coast Range and the Cascade Range, but his expertise is such that he is available nation-wide for contracts, part-time work and for expert testimony. He is licensed in Oregon as a Professional Geologist and as a Certified Water Right Examiner.

Wellsite Geologist/Geosteering

Empirica Surface Logging, Ltd

Houston, Texas Area

The oil business is booming again, in the west, from North Dakota to Texas. Wellsite geologists (mudloggers and geosteering experts) are the first observers to see drilling cuttings that come up with the returning drilling mud in new vertical and horizontal wells. I have served in this wellsite capacity in the Eagle Ford horizontal drilling trend, near San Antonio, Texas in the Bakken horizontal trend near Williston, North Dakota and in Midland, Texas doing wellsite mudlogging. My work was as a "Second Hand" or "Night Logger".

Project Geologist, East Side Centralized Storm Overflow Project

Foundation Engineering Incorporated

Portland, Oregon Area

Described the soil cuttings and rock core. Found silt and clay-filled buried channels and documented those with geoprobe soundings. Found areas of very hard drilling in large basalt boulders and alerted the prime contractor to those changes. Discovered formation water-gain layers and water-loss strata that would slow tunneling progress. Due in part to these observations, this $1.5 Billion stormwater tunnel project was completed five months ahead of schedule. System operators claim that the outfall has captured more of the high runoff flows than anticipated, due to manipulation of the series of large pumps.

Hydrologist, Detroit Ranger District

Detroit Lake, Oregon

Documented and evaluated more than 100 forest road damage sites, caused by the February 1996 Storm and by later storm events. Described landslides and debris torrents at flood and live stream crossings. Recommended repairs and upgrades of destroyed or damaged forest road bridges and culverts to engineers and Forest Service managers.

Petroleum Geologist

Oklahoma City, Oklahoma Area

Petroleum Geologist in charge of making oil and gas prospects in five north-central Oklahoma counties. Site geologist on other wells in Caddo County and in southern Kansas, north to Hays. This post provided training in geological mapping and preparing cross-sections to find the best locations for new wells. The work was to develop new oil/gas fields in extensive lease holdings by Gulf. Each well cost $1.3 Million. Present day (2013) cost for a directional well in the same location is more than $12 Million. Major target formations were the Mississippi Solid and the Hunton Formation (Devonian), where production was enhanced by rock fractures.
